The challenges of urban poverty

Despite the many advantages of city life, urban poverty remains a major challenge in many areas. Lack of access to quality education, healthcare, and affordable housing can make it difficult for people to escape poverty and build better lives for themselves and their families.

The impact of gentrification

Gentrification is a controversial topic in many cities. While it can bring economic growth and revitalization to struggling neighborhoods, it can also lead to displacement of long-time residents and loss of community identity.
